BioCulus™ turns polyester textile waste into high-quality filament yarn using a biological recycling with an enzymatic process powered by REO-ECO’s vertical in-house production.

With our patented enzyme technology, we regenerate polyester at a molecular level. This enables infinite recycling while maintaining
virgin-grade quality.

By the end of 2025, we will have the capacity to produce 10,000 tons of BioCulus™ rPET chips & yarn/year

Waterless colouring

No water is used in the dyeing stage, saving a precious resource from the start.


Low chemical use

Pigments are added directly into the polymer, reducing the need for harsh chemicals.


Energy efficient

By eliminating the traditional dyeing step, the process becomes faster and uses less energy.

Due to the low temperature (60-65 C) and pressure needed for this process the energy consumption is low.

Process


Process

Textile Waste

Post-Consumer & Post-Industrial Waste.

Sorting

Automated sorting.

Shredding

Shredding the textile into small pieces

Enzymatic Depolymerisation

The waste is placed in the reaktor where our enzymes is breaking down the polymer chains.

Monomer Purification & Re-Polymerisation

The PTA + MEG is recovered and recombined ready to be added again into production of rPET Chips.

rPET Chips

The BioCulus rPET chips.

Weaving & Knitting

Yarn

The result is a high-performance fabric; durable, colourfast, and resource-smart.

Fabric

Product
